Comprehensive Service Overview
When a garage door stops working properly in Durham, the underlying cause often ties back to the region's climate and the age of the home. A door that won't open on a January morning might have a frozen seal, a snapped torsion spring, or an opener board that gave out from years of temperature swings. Understanding what's happening starts with a careful look at the door's mechanical and electronic systems.
Spring and cable issues are among the most common repairs. These high-tension components bear the weight of the door and eventually wear out. Because of the cold winters in Greene County, metal fatigue can set in faster than in milder climates. A broken spring means the door won't lift smoothly—or at all—and should never be handled without proper training and tools.
Opener troubleshooting is another frequent need. Whether it's a LiftMaster, Chamberlain, or Genie unit, opener problems can stem from dead remote batteries, misaligned safety sensors, worn gears, or failing circuit boards. Power surges common in rural areas can also damage electronics. A thorough diagnosis helps determine whether a simple sensor realignment or a full replacement is the right path.
Track and roller issues often develop slowly. A door that starts grinding, shaking, or sitting unevenly may have bent tracks, worn rollers, or loose hardware. Left unchecked, these problems can lead to a door coming off its tracks entirely. Regular attention to alignment and lubrication goes a long way in extending the life of the system.

Regional Characteristics
Durham sits in the foothills of the Catskill Mountains, where the landscape is a mix of wooded hillsides, valley farmland, and winding country roads. Housing stock here spans from historic 19th-century farmhouses to mid-century ranches and newer custom builds. Many homes have detached garages or carriage houses converted for vehicle storage. Winters bring snow, ice, and freezing temperatures, while spring thaws and summer humidity add their own seasonal stresses. Properties are often spread out, meaning response times and service availability can vary depending on location and road conditions.
Common Issues
Cold weather is hard on garage door springs, lubricants, and opener mechanisms—sticking or frozen doors are common in winter months. Snow and ice buildup at the base of the door can prevent proper sealing and operation. Older homes may have non-standard door sizes or outdated hardware that makes finding replacement parts more involved. Rural properties also contend with occasional power fluctuations that affect opener electronics, and dirt roads can kick up debris that settles in tracks and rollers over time.
